Choose a role based on the work the person needs to do. Owners manage the business and team access; schedulers organise work; team members work with assigned Visits. Verify the actual signed-in view before handing over responsibility, because a role label alone does not explain every workflow.

Match responsibilities to the current controls

This table summarises the product routes and actions checked for these guides. Plan availability and an active business membership also apply. It is a practical workflow summary, not a claim that every internal field is visible to every person in a role.

Selected Daylane role boundariesScroll for more columns →
TaskOwnerSchedulerTeam member
Invite/manage team accessYes, subject to plan/seatsNo owner invitation controlsNo
Create/reschedule work and change assignmentsYesYesNo management action
Review booking/change requestsYesYesNo
Import Customer CSVYesYesNo
Update assigned Visit progressYesYesAssigned Visits
Edit working AvailabilityYesYesView own arrangement

Check the assigned person's working view

A team member should be assigned to the Visit they need to open and update. Customer and Job administration pages have broader management boundaries, so do not assume they can browse the whole business to find an instruction.

Put necessary attendance detail into the fields available in the Visit workflow. Test the handover with the person's role and a clearly labelled practice scenario before relying on it for a customer booking.

Review access when responsibilities change

If someone begins scheduling for others, decide whether the scheduler role is appropriate instead of sharing an owner's credentials. If someone stops working with the business, use the owner's team-management process to review access and future assignments.

Keep notification preferences separate from scheduling authority. A person receiving an email about a Visit does not by itself establish permission to edit every related business record.
